*The following are the basic parameters of the product, involving the characteristics of the product and its category
| TYPE | DESCRIPTION |
|---|---|
| Part Status | Active |
| RoHS Status | ROHS3 Compliant |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) |
| Mounting Type | Surface Mount |
| Mount | Surface Mount |
| Packaging | Tape & Reel (TR) |
| Number of Elements | 1 |
| ECCN Code | EAR99 |
| ESD Protection | No |
| JESD-609 Code | e3 |
| Lead Free | Lead Free |
| Contact Plating | Tin |
| Tolerance | ±1% |
| Terminal Position | DUAL |
| Number of Terminations | 3 |
| Number of Pins | 3 |
| Pin Count | 3 |
| Published | 2013 |
| Terminal Form | GULL WING |
| Peak Reflow Temperature (Cel) | 260 |
| Max Power Dissipation | 250mW |
| Power Dissipation | 250mW |
| Voltage Tol-Max | 1% |
| Voltage Tolerance | 1% |
| Factory Lead Time | 4 Weeks |
| Time@Peak Reflow Temperature-Max (s) | 30 |
| Diode Element Material | SILICON |
| Element Configuration | Single |
| Reference Voltage | 75V |
| Zener Voltage | 75V |
| Operating Temperature | -65°C~150°C |
| Polarity | UNIDIRECTIONAL |
| Diode Type | ZENER DIODE |
| HTS Code | 8541.10.00.50 |
| Series | Automotive, AEC-Q101 |
| Technology | ZENER |
| Package / Case | TO-236-3, SC-59, SOT-23-3 |
| Test Current | 2mA |
| Voltage – Forward (Vf) (Max) @ If | 900mV @ 10mA |
| Max Reverse Leakage Current | 50nA |
| Impedance-Max | 255Ohm |
| Impedance | 255Ohm |
| Current – Reverse Leakage @ Vr | 50nA @ 52.5V |
| Base Part Number | BZX84A75 |
